Community Engagement & Philanthropy 

At The Container Store, we believe in the transformative power of organized spaces, knowing that they enhance quality of life. This belief drives our TCS Gives Back Program, with a focus on healthy brains and healthy hearts

For over a decade, we’ve proudly supported the Center for BrainHealth, contributing over $1.3 million to vital research and programs. Recognizing the connection between brain health and cardiovascular health, we selected the American Heart Association as our 2024-2025 national nonprofit partner by joining their Life Is Why™ cause marketing campaign to inspire everyone to celebrate their reasons to live healthier, longer lives. 

Employee Programs 

The Container Store’s Employee First Fund, established in 2013, provides grants to employees that are experiencing unforeseen financial hardship due to a major medical situation, a catastrophic event, or other grave challenges. A company contribution set up the Fund, and employee contributions and other company stakeholders provide financial support to the Fund today. To date, The Container Store’s Employee First Fund has awarded more than $1 million in grants to employees in need. 

The Employee First Fund is recognized as a charitable organization under section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code. Contributions are tax-deductible to the extent permitted by law.
